CR200J1动车组列供系统电源低频电磁干扰研究

摘    要:文章分析了四象限整流器的工作原理,对列供系统电源的电场、磁场干扰源进行了分析归纳.在此基础上,对其电磁场发射进行了推导,给出了磁场的频谱特性.最后,测试了 CR200J1动车组列供系统的低频磁场,结果表明其磁场发射依然以2.15 kHz的开关频率为主,差模电流是主要的磁场发射源.

Research on low-frequency EMI of power supply in auxiliary power supply system of CR200J1 EMU

Abstract:This paper analyzes the working principle of four-quadrant rectifier,and summarizes the electric and magnetic interference source of power supply of auxiliary power supply system.On this basis,the electromagnetic emission is derived and the spectral characteristic of magnetic field is given.Finally,the low-frequency magnetic field of auxiliary power supply system of CR200J1 EMU is measured.The result shows that the major magnetic field emission is occupied by 2.15 kHz switching frequency part,and the differential current is key source of magnetic field emission.
